TitleContribution of microbial activities and stocks to the C and P biogeochemical cycles in a frontal zone of the Southern Adriatic Sea (Gulf of Manfredonia).
AbstractThe study was performed ffrom 15 to 27 May 2003 in the Gulf of Manfredonia during the SAMCA 3 cruise (System Approach to Mediterranean Coastal Areas) wihin the Cluster-SAM program. A total of 51 samples were collected from 16 stations along 4 transects. In this report, we focused on physical, chemical and microbiological analyses (primary production, net bacterial production, bacterial stock and ectoenzymatic activities related to Carbon, Nitrogen and Phosphorus cycles) carried on 35 samples collected along a coastal-offshore transect. Multivariate statistical analysis was applied to four water masses (inner, outer, transitional and deeper group). Different relationships were observed between bacterial and environmental parameters in the water masses, suggesting the occurrence within them of some variations in biogeochemical cycles.
